Summary

The FDA issued a Class III for Salt by United Salt Corp. Reason: Plain salt was labeled as iodized and iodized salt was labeled as plain..

Context & Analysis

This is a Class III recall. Class III recalls involve products unlikely to cause adverse health consequences, but that violate FDA regulations.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is a Class III recall?

A Class III recall involves products that are unlikely to cause adverse health effects but violate FDA labeling or manufacturing regulations.

What should I do if I have this product?

Stop using the product. Check the product against the specific lot numbers or identifiers listed in the recall. Contact the manufacturer (United Salt Corp) or your retailer for a refund or replacement. If you experienced adverse effects, report them to the FDA via MedWatch.
